Gate Latch Repair Questions
What causes gate latch issues? Wear and tear, misalignment, or debris can prevent a gate latch from functioning properly.
How can a damaged gate latch be fixed? Repair typically involves realigning, replacing parts, or adjusting the latch mechanism for smooth operation.
Are there different types of gate latches? Yes, common types include slide latches, keyed latches, and gravity latches, each suited for specific gate styles.
When should a gate latch be replaced? Replacement is recommended if the latch is broken, rusted beyond repair, or no longer secures the gate properly.
